Maryland Regina Premo

 

HAINES CITY - Maryland Regina Premo, 94, of Hampton Court, Haines City, FL, passed away peacefully Saturday (February 6, 2010) at the Good Shepherd Hospice, Auburndale, FL, after a brief illness.  

Born July 10, 1915, in Louisville, NY, she was the daughter of the late John A. "Sandy" and Caroline M. Doud Premo.  She was raised in the Massena, NY, area. 

She worked primarily for the State of New Jersey as a secretary/bookkeeper until moving to Florida in 1977 where she eventually retired.  She loved life and was a former member of the St. Joseph's Catholic Church, Winter Haven, FL.   

She was predeceased by her sister, Margaret F. Premo (Philip) Mulvey, and her brothers, Alfred J. Premo, Bernard W. Premo, Mervyn A."Buck"(Marion) Premo, and infant Leon Premo.   

Surviving are two nephews, Patrick M.(Kathleen) Premo of Allegany, NY, and Dale J. (Doreen) Premo of Orrtanna, PA, as well as four great nieces and nephews, Maureen N. Premo of Arlington, VA, Eileen C. Premo of Los Angeles, CA, Daniel P. Premo of Atlanta, GA,  and Michael H. Premo of Gaithersburg, MD.  

At Ms. Premo's request, there will be no visitation.  Memorials may be made to the donor’s choice.
